Output d7bb63f7190b031ff044233b42722b75aa25dfebe37f8d7d36e4ea0fd811f5e8:58

value
17724
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4de3e582338f406e3121645f2efb45828effa2f9 OP_EQUAL
address
38nrxqoxehGRWEERAtbS68tw1VNFSbrYTs
transaction
d7bb63f7190b031ff044233b42722b75aa25dfebe37f8d7d36e4ea0fd811f5e8
confirmations
223043
spent
true